Ldap clear text. That requires adding the appropriate security controls.

In a network trace Jun 5, 2024 · This is because credentials are transmitted in clear text. Here's how to check for and solve that problem. You preferably want to use an encrypted form of LDAP instead of cleartext. The LAN Manager OWF password is 16 bytes long. You can create a Simple Bind using this option in LDP. tldp. LDAP can use multiple authentication methods. Preferred type of connection between a managed device and the LDAP Lightweight Directory Access Protocol. com/en-us/azure-advanced-threat-protection/atp-cas-isp-clear-text. start-tls The problem is the django auth-ldap sends this ldap password data in clear text, and the AD i'm trying to authenticate with is not setup for LDAPs tcp/636 (I don't have control of that) so i cant use the command AUTH_LDAP_START_TLS = True. Jan 9, 2024 · The security of Active Directory domain controllers can be significantly improved by configuring the server to reject Simple Authentication and Security Layer (SASL) LDAP binds that do not request signing (integrity verification) or to reject LDAP simple binds that are performed on a clear text (non-SSL/TLS-encrypted) connection. AD team has noticed that CUCM is sending end user credentials in clear text towards AD servers. Feb 24, 2020 · Lightweight Directory Access Protocol (LDAP) implements a protocol for accessing and maintaining directory information services. (Examples are the PAM and simple LDAP authentication plugins; see Section 8. A client that sends a LDAP request without doing a "bind" is treated as an anonymous client. If you select this option, then you must select Trusted Root CA or Certificate Database Path. To access the LDAP service, the LDAP client first must authenticate itself to the service. Select OK. - Domain Controller (AD) name. But, yeah, they're generally stored in some encrypted/hashed fashion. If you do not enable SSL, user credentials are passed to the LDAP server in clear text. Therefore, there's no secure key material to provide protection. You may have heard that you need to configure legacy third-party apps to use Secure LDAP instead of clear-text LDAP. Simple authentication consists of sending the LDAP server the fully qualified DN of the client (user) and the client's clear-text password. It would depend on the LDAP server, specifically, how passwords are handled. These sessions should be disabled by setting LDAPServerIntegrity to Required . LDAP is a communication protocol that provides the ability to access and maintain distributed directory information services over a network. . Clients and applications authenticate with Windows Active Directory (AD) using LDAP bind operations. 7, “LDAP Pluggable Authentication” . Hypertext Transfer Protocol (HTTP) is a clear-text-based, request-response and client-server protocol. 3. ldap-s. It is the standard type of network activity to request/serve web pages, and by default, it is not blocked by any network perimeter. Jan 8, 2020 · Although Microsoft has a permanent fix on the way, it's possible that you're exposing domain admin account credentials in cleartext. This feature allows you to use special characters in LDAP usernames. Depending on policy configuration, LAPS passwords may be stored in either clear-text form or encrypted form. One of the Identity Security Posture assessments part of Defender for Identity is “Entities exposing credentials in clear text Jan 8, 2020 · Although Microsoft has a permanent fix on the way, it's possible that you're exposing domain admin account credentials in cleartext. Aug 25, 2020 · Entities exposing credentials in clear text are risky not only for the exposed entity in question, but for your entire organization. Please see my script below is there any enhancements/script I can add easily, to continue using ldap/389 Sending LDAP passwords in clear text was never a good idea, but a Windows update due in March will make it also painful. Does AD on server 2019 or 2022 allow a simple or regular unencrypted bind on port 389? I believe this option was completely blocked as a result of…. These types of attacks result in malicious activities including Aug 15, 2018 · CUCM version 11. Nov 8, 2016 · (2) A LDAP simple bind that was performed on a clear text (non-SSL/TLS-encrypted) connection This directory server is not currently configured to reject such binds. In that time, the protocol has expanded and evolved to meet changing IT environments and business needs. LDAP bind requests provide the ability to use either simple authentication or SASL authentication. Luckily, a Domain Controller audits unsigned LDAP binds, including a Simple Bind, using Event ID 2887 in the Directory Service log, which is on by default. LDAP v3 still supports simple binds without encryption. The Get-LapsADPassword cmdlet automatically decrypts encrypted passwords. Is it because LDAPS(secured) is not enabled or there could be any other reasons for this. In some directory servers, it's possible to store user Apr 24, 2020 · Hi @philipperismann, Have you seen our security assessment for exposing credentials in clear text? https://docs. The increased risk is because unsecure traffic such as LDAP simple-bind is highly susceptible to interception by attacker-in-the-middle attacks. In a network trace Authentication using LDAP - Linux Documentation Project 6. Feb 6, 2020 · In the user interface, follow Assets → Activity → LDAP → Servers. Select Browse, and then select Default Domain Policy (or the Group Policy Object for which you want to enable client LDAP signing). Selecting LDAP over SSL automatically populates the Port field to 636. 1. The Lightweight Directory Access Protocol (LDAP) is used by directory clients to access data held by directory servers. The most basic method is Mar 4, 2021 · In this use case the customer had started a project to eliminate the use of LDAP Simple Bind. Therefore it is prone to eavesdropping as any other clear text protocol. Oct 5, 2023 · The Windows LDAP bind security vulnerability you should know about. Step-1: I will create a simple LDAP client in Python and make a search request for an object. Use the Password Policy overlay and specify hashing of plaintext passwords: Thank you so much for the answer. The Get-LapsADPassword cmdlet allows administrators to retrieve LAPS passwords and password history for an Active Directory computer or domain controller object. Apr 24, 2020 · Hi @philipperismann, Have you seen our security assessment for exposing credentials in clear text? https://docs. 4. As a layman in ldap can you suggest me how to apply this setting. Defender For Endpoint Sending LDAP passwords in clear text was never a good idea, but a Windows update due in March will make it also painful. The default order of connection type is: 1. Organizations can make LDAP more secure by adding transmission encryption, such as Transport Layer Security (TLS). For connections by accounts that use this plugin, client programs use the client-side mysql_clear_password plugin, which sends the password to the server as cleartext. Please let me know if you are aware of this issue. using LDAP - Connector server computer name - Connector server IP address. Sending LDAP passwords in clear text was never a good idea, but a Windows update due in March will make it also painful. 5, “PAM Pluggable Authentication” , and Section 8. Jun 30, 2022 · If the you plan to use CHAP authentication with an LDAP backing store, the password in LDAP must be stored as clear text. The OWF version of this password is also known as the LAN Manager OWF or ESTD version. This post covers everything you need to know about LDAP, from its Jan 8, 2020 · Although Microsoft has a permanent fix on the way, it's possible that you're exposing domain admin account credentials in cleartext. There are different kinds of LDAP bind operations, including: Jan 8, 2020 · Although Microsoft has a permanent fix on the way, it's possible that you're exposing domain admin account credentials in cleartext. You can get this list after you have integrated AATP with MCAS. In a network trace Apr 24, 2020 · Hi @philipperismann, Have you seen our security assessment for exposing credentials in clear text? https://docs. Anyone who might be sniffing the network traffic would see this information and could then start impersonating the user. xml: <welcome-file-list>. Mar 16, 2022 · When SASL binding is not used, there is a potential that the credentials used during the bind process were sent in clear text. Ldapv3 supports three types of authentication: anonymous, simple and SASL authentication. If security settings have not been enabled on the LDAP client and LDAP server, that information will cross the network as clear text. Authentication using LDAP. We will use the module to create a search request. Set-WinADDiagnostics -Diagnostics 'LDAP Interface Events' -Level Basic -SkipRoDC. In a network trace Jan 8, 2020 · Although Microsoft has a permanent fix on the way, it's possible that you're exposing domain admin account credentials in cleartext. LDAP servers, therefore, are both attractive targets and vulnerable to man-in-the-middle and eavesdropping attacks. LDAP clients that do not use encryption send all LDAP traffic (including the credentials used in an LDAP bind) over clear text. This password is computed by using DES encryption to encrypt a constant with the clear text password. It typically runs on port tcp/389 as plain text service, unencrypted. This is due to the one-way hash used by the CHAP, crypt, SHA-1, and SSHA encryption algorithms. Table 1 shows a compatibility matrix of LDAP signing using SASL binds. 2. Simple Bind: Authentication happen using user name and password, password is transmitted in clear text. TLS will use certificates on both sides, suplicant and server authentication server. Or you can buy a 3rd party SSL cert too but this can be trickier if your domain uses a non-standard TLD such as . Jun 30, 2015 · I have implemented LDAP authentication in my application. Port: LDAP typically uses port 389 for Sep 9, 2009 · "Security-ACS uses SSL to encrypt communication between ACS and the LDAP server. Select Finish. We can also run verification of whether our change did happen. ->we have observed that when ever the im_ccs and im_jcs Rather, mysql_clear_password can be used on the client side in concert with any server-side plugin that needs a cleartext password. *GTC if I'm not wrong is a OTP system to use with EAP. In a network trace Jan 19, 2020 · This command contains the ability to exclude, include domains, domain controllers, so it's easy to enable it on one DC or just one domain within a forest. Apr 4, 2019 · An LDAP Simple Bind will send username and password in clear text to provide credentials to the LDAP server. server. Show 2 more. <welcome-file>LoginServlet</welcome-file>. Dec 3, 2020 · 2. Apr 24, 2020 · Hi, is there a possibility to get all the Computers where a "Authentication with clear text credentials using LDAP simple bind from. ACS supports only server-side authentication for SSL communication with the LDAP Sending LDAP passwords in clear text was never a good idea, but a Windows update due in March will make it also painful. May 19, 2022 · All information, including usernames and passwords, are transmitted as clear text by default. Under Top SASL Authentication Mechanisms, click Simple and then Records. That requires adding the appropriate security controls. This is not secure, so if your application is using simple binds it needs to be reconfigured or updated. ) Apr 24, 2020 · Hi @philipperismann, Have you seen our security assessment for exposing credentials in clear text? https://docs. LDAP you can only use with TLS, PEAP-GTC and EAP-FAST-GTC. If it isn’t possible to use SASL, you must implement LDAP encryption to prevent LDAP clients from transmitting credentials in clear text. NOTE: In a production environment, security is a concern because when Policy Manager binds to an LDAP server, it submits the username and password for that account over the network under clear text unless you protect it using Connection Security and set the port to 636. org May 13, 2020 · If any of your Domain Controllers have the 2886 event present, it indicates that LDAP signing is not being enforced by your DC and it is possible to perform a simple (clear text) LDAP bind over a non-encrypted connection. . That is, it must tell the LDAP server who is going to be accessing the data so that the server can decide what the client is allowed to see and do. – Mar 24, 2022 · When SASL binding is used, the LDAP client and LDAP server negotiate on the authentication protocol to be used, such as Kerberos or NTLM. How can we send them in post method or in some encrypted format? Please help. Aug 11, 2021 · The Ultimate Guide. exe or calling the LDAP_Simple_bind function in your code. Step-2: "python-ldap" module provides an object-oriented API to access LDAP directory servers from Python programs. Sep 26, 2023 · Protocol: LDAP operates over a clear-text connection by default, which means that data transferred between the LDAP client and server is not encrypted. This configuration is controlled by the security option «Domain controller: LDAP server signing requirements». The server-side authentication_ldap_simple plugin performs simple LDAP authentication. microsoft. clear-text. Jan 2, 2024 · Let’s see it with naked eyes. In a network trace Feb 1, 2023 · First published on MSDN on Apr 10, 2017 Step-by-step guide for setting up LDAPS (LDAP over SSL)The guide is split into 3 sections : Create a Windows Server VM. If you want to see if this is a serious problem (passwords used in clear text), you can download the PCAPs for inspection. The security of this directory server can be significantly enhanced by configuring the server to reject such binds. Thanks, Faraz Siddiqi Apr 4, 2019 · An LDAP Simple Bind will send username and password in clear text to provide credentials to the LDAP server. Web. Event 2887 occurs every 24 hours and will report how many unsigned and clear text binds have occurred to the Domain Controller. Microsoft Defender for Identity monitors information generated from your organization's Active Directory, network activities and event activities to detect suspicious activity. Jun 5, 2024 · This is because credentials are transmitted in clear text. The monitored activity information enables Defender for Identity to help you determine the validity of each potential threat and correctly triage and respond. Feb 22, 2024 · Select Start > Run, type mmc. exe, and then select OK. local Mar 4, 2024 · LDAP is used to read, write and modify Active Directory objects. Microsoft. Allowing Special Characters in LDAP Usernames. 2. conf, but if you don't know how to configure OpenLDAP you're the wrong person to be asking this question anyway. Jun 5, 2024 · This is because credentials are transmitted in clear text. The Microsoft Defender for Identity sensor detects clear text credentials by decoding the Bind request, looking for “Simple” authentication. 5 with LDAP integration on port 389. ->The above alert is reported in " Azure ATP - monitors AD activity". But user Name password we are giving as input going in CLEAR format. If you don't want that, you have to disable it. Yes. Jul 8, 2024 · Today, LDAP authentications are more often crossing the public internet within remote and hybrid environments. Sep 22, 2011 · There is a table that says that LDAP isn't a db compatible with our EAP type (MSCHAP-V2). This isn’t necessarily a bad thing if the LDAP bind was performed using SASL. Passwords should be transmitted in clear text - not hashed - over a secure connection to a server that supports password quality checks and password history enforcement unless the LDAP client provides password quality and history checks, otherwise, the server will not be able to enforce the quality and history. As a result, Active Directory attributes and the credentials used to authenticate could be easily readable to an Adversary-in-the-Middle (AiTM). As a result of being unencrypted and the backbone of web traffic, HTTP is one of the must-to-know protocols in Feb 4, 2020 · Event 2886 indicates that LDAP signing is not being enforced by your Domain Controller and it is possible to perform a simple (clear text) LDAP bind over a non-encrypted connection. In slapd. Jul 3, 2009 · This password is not case sensitive and can be up to 14 characters long. In a network trace Mar 22, 2020 · Alert is raised when it happens " ADMIN Authenticated with Clear Text credentials using LDAP simple bind ". This query visualises the top 100 Devices that initiate the most clear text LDAP authentications. For nearly 3 decades, organizations have been using the LDAP (Lightweight Directory Access Protocol) for user management, attributes, and authentication. In the Oracle Directory Server, for example, password policies have a "Password storage scheme" which controls how the password is stored. In a network trace Jan 23, 2024 · Mitigation. Sep 30, 2013 · 1. Aug 3, 2019 · LDAP bind operations are used to authenticate clients to the directory server (clients could be users or application behind users). In the Add or Remove Snap-ins dialog box, select Group Policy Object Editor, and then select Add. Check out the video below to see a quick demo, showing how easy this is. cd vz gn rh gm zz hi ur wd yo  Banner